In anticipation of seeing Dwayne Johnson kicking ass in his fourth Fast and Furious flick, the folks at Burger Fiction on YouTube put together a video outlining his acting evolution. Of course, it has to start with some WWF highlights before going into the genesis of his illustrious Hollywood career. First up is a 1999 cameo you may have forgotten about in That ‘70s Show, in which he branched out to play, yes, a wrestler. Other old school bits that’ll make you go, “Oh, yeah!” include Star Trek: Voyager, an early SNL hosting gig, and co-starring alongside Stifler himself, Seann William Scott, in The Rundown. And if you forgot how bad the CGI was in The Mummy Returns, you can glimpse that, too.

What do all of these acting highlights have in common? The Rock has been damn charming since the very beginning of his career.
